Unlit, the same texture catches daylight along every ridge and holds its own by day.\u003c\/span\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003c\/ul\u003e\n\u003cp class=\"spec-heading\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eDimensions \u0026amp; Placement\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p class=\"spec-heading\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003e\u003cimg src=\"https:\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0848\/5591\/4801\/files\/onda-adjustable-cable-cluster-pendant-korewolamp-technical-dimension-drawing-80cm-diameter-specifications.webp?v=1785826184\" alt=\"\"\u003e\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"pd-dim-hero\"\u003e\n\u003cspan class=\"big\"\u003e∅ 31.5″ × H 25.2″\u003c\/span\u003e \u003cspan class=\"sub\"\u003e∅ 80 × H 64 cm · tiered cascade · chain suspension, adjustable\u003c\/span\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cul class=\"pd-place\"\u003e\n\u003cli\u003e\n\u003cspan class=\"ic\"\u003e\u003csvg viewbox=\"0 0 24 24\" fill=\"none\" stroke=\"currentColor\" stroke-width=\"1.9\" stroke-linecap=\"round\" stroke-linejoin=\"round\"\u003e\u003crect x=\"3\" y=\"10\" width=\"18\" height=\"3\" rx=\"1\"\u003e\u003c\/rect\u003e\u003cpath d=\"M5 13v7M19 13v7M8 10V7h8v3\"\u003e\u003c\/path\u003e\u003c\/svg\u003e\u003c\/span\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"tx\"\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003eOver a Round Dining Table\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003cspan\u003eBest above a round table \u003cb\u003e42–47″ (107–119 cm)\u003c\/b\u003e across — roughly two thirds to three quarters of the table width. Hang the lowest panel \u003cb\u003e30–36″ (75–90 cm)\u003c\/b\u003e above the tabletop.\u003c\/span\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003cli\u003e\n\u003cspan class=\"ic\"\u003e\u003csvg viewbox=\"0 0 24 24\" fill=\"none\" stroke=\"currentColor\" stroke-width=\"1.9\" stroke-linecap=\"round\" stroke-linejoin=\"round\"\u003e\u003cpath d=\"M4 21V10l8-6 8 6v11\"\u003e\u003c\/path\u003e\u003cpath d=\"M9 21v-6h6v6\"\u003e\u003c\/path\u003e\u003c\/svg\u003e\u003c\/span\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"tx\"\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003eEntry Hall \u0026amp; Stairwell\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003cspan\u003eAt \u003cb\u003eH 25.2″\u003c\/b\u003e this has real depth, so it wants ceilings of \u003cb\u003e10 ft (3 m)\u003c\/b\u003e or more — and it is at its best in a stairwell or two-storey entry where the tiers are seen from more than one level. Keep \u003cb\u003e7 ft (2.1 m)\u003c\/b\u003e of floor clearance in any walkway.\u003c\/span\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003cli\u003e\n\u003cspan class=\"ic\"\u003e\u003csvg viewbox=\"0 0 24 24\" fill=\"none\" stroke=\"currentColor\" stroke-width=\"1.9\" stroke-linecap=\"round\" stroke-linejoin=\"round\"\u003e\u003crect x=\"2\" y=\"8\" width=\"20\" height=\"10\" rx=\"2\"\u003e\u003c\/rect\u003e\u003cpath d=\"M6 18v2M18 18v2\"\u003e\u003c\/path\u003e\u003c\/svg\u003e\u003c\/span\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"tx\"\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003eLiving Room \u0026amp; Bedroom\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003cspan\u003eSized for rooms of roughly \u003cb\u003e14 × 17 ft (4.3 × 5.2 m)\u003c\/b\u003e — add your room's length and width in feet and read the sum as inches. Centre it over the seating area rather than the middle of the room.\u003c\/span\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003cli\u003e\n\u003cspan class=\"ic\"\u003e\u003csvg viewbox=\"0 0 24 24\" fill=\"none\" stroke=\"currentColor\" stroke-width=\"1.9\" stroke-linecap=\"round\" stroke-linejoin=\"round\"\u003e\u003ccircle cx=\"12\" cy=\"12\" r=\"9\"\u003e\u003c\/circle\u003e\u003cpath d=\"M12 8v5M12 16h.01\"\u003e\u003c\/path\u003e\u003c\/svg\u003e\u003c\/span\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"tx\"\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003eWhere It Must Not Go\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003cspan\u003eAn \u003cb\u003eindoor, dry-location\u003c\/b\u003e fixture. Not for a bathroom, above a bath or shower, in a laundry, or on a covered porch or balcony — those need a damp- or wet-rated fixture.\u003c\/span\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003c\/ul\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"pd-tip\"\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003eHanging Height Tip\u003c\/strong\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eA simple guide: allow about \u003cb\u003e2.5–3″ of drop for every foot of ceiling height\u003c\/b\u003e. Remember this fixture is \u003cb\u003e25.2″ deep on its own\u003c\/b\u003e before the chain is added, so measure from the ceiling to the bottom of the lowest panel rather than to the frame. In a standard 9 ft room that leaves very little chain — below 10 ft ceilings, check the numbers before ordering.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eOver a dining table you can hang it lower — \u003cb\u003e30–36″ above the tabletop\u003c\/b\u003e — because nobody walks beneath it. That is diffusion done by shape rather than by a frosted coating, and it is why there is no visible source, no hotspot and no hard-edged shadow on a table.\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/details\u003e\n\u003cdetails class=\"kfq-item\"\u003e\n\u003csummary\u003e\u003cspan class=\"kfq-num\"\u003e03\u003c\/span\u003e\u003cspan class=\"kfq-q\"\u003eWill it fit my ceiling height?\u003c\/span\u003e\u003cspan class=\"kfq-ico\"\u003e\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/summary\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"kfq-a\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eCheck this before anything else. The fixture is \u003cstrong\u003e25.2 in (64 cm) deep on its own, before the chain is added\u003c\/strong\u003e — so measure from your ceiling down to where the \u003cem\u003elowest panel\u003c\/em\u003e would sit, not to the frame.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eIt wants ceilings of \u003cstrong\u003e10 ft (3 m) or more\u003c\/strong\u003e. In a standard 9 ft room there is very little chain left once the fixture itself is accounted for. Over a dining table you can go lower, since nobody walks beneath it — but in a walkway you need \u003cstrong\u003e7 ft (2.1 m)\u003c\/strong\u003e of floor clearance under the lowest panel. If you are between sizes on height, tell us your ceiling and we will do the arithmetic with you.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/details\u003e\n\u003cdetails class=\"kfq-item\"\u003e\n\u003csummary\u003e\u003cspan class=\"kfq-num\"\u003e04\u003c\/span\u003e\u003cspan class=\"kfq-q\"\u003eWhat size room does it suit?\u003c\/span\u003e\u003cspan class=\"kfq-ico\"\u003e\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/summary\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"kfq-a\"\u003eAt \u003cstrong\u003e∅ 31.5 in (80 cm)\u003c\/strong\u003e it suits a \u003cstrong\u003eround table of 42–47 in\u003c\/strong\u003e — take about two thirds to three quarters of the table width. From across a room the cascade reads as one form; stand underneath and every panel is its own.\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/details\u003e\n\u003cdetails class=\"kfq-item\"\u003e\n\u003csummary\u003e\u003cspan class=\"kfq-num\"\u003e08\u003c\/span\u003e\u003cspan class=\"kfq-q\"\u003eIs it difficult to install?\u003c\/span\u003e\u003cspan class=\"kfq-ico\"\u003e\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/summary\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"kfq-a\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eIt is a \u003cstrong\u003ehardwired ceiling fixture\u003c\/strong\u003e and we recommend a licensed electrician. The frame and chain go up first, then the panels are hung tier by tier — that part takes patience rather than skill, and \u003cstrong\u003etwo people make it far easier\u003c\/strong\u003e: one supporting, one hanging. Work from the top tier down and switch off at the breaker first.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eOn weight: a full cascade of solid glass panels is \u003cstrong\u003eheavier than it looks\u003c\/strong\u003e. Confirm your junction box is rated for it and properly supported before you order — a standard box holds far less than most people assume.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/details\u003e\n\u003cdetails class=\"kfq-item\"\u003e\n\u003csummary\u003e\u003cspan class=\"kfq-num\"\u003e09\u003c\/span\u003e\u003cspan class=\"kfq-q\"\u003eWill the glass arrive safely?\u003c\/span\u003e\u003cspan class=\"kfq-ico\"\u003e\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/summary\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"kfq-a\"\u003eEvery panel is \u003cstrong\u003eindividually wrapped and foam-seated\u003c\/strong\u003e inside a reinforced box, with the frame and hardware packed separately from the glass. Because each panel hangs on its own, \u003cstrong\u003ea single damaged panel never means returning the whole chandelier.\u003c\/strong\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/details\u003e\n\u003cdetails class=\"kfq-item\"\u003e\n\u003csummary\u003e\u003cspan class=\"kfq-num\"\u003e10\u003c\/span\u003e\u003cspan class=\"kfq-q\"\u003eHow do I clean it?\u003c\/span\u003e\u003cspan class=\"kfq-ico\"\u003e\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/summary\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"kfq-a\"\u003eA \u003cstrong\u003esoft dry cloth\u003c\/strong\u003e for dust, barely damp for marks, wiping \u003cstrong\u003ealong the arcs rather than across them\u003c\/strong\u003e so the cloth does not catch. Work from the top tier down, so dust falls away from what you have already cleaned. Avoid scouring pads and ammonia sprays — the granular surface holds residue. Switch off and let the bulbs cool completely first. Once or twice a year is plenty.\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/details\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"kfq-foot\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eStill have a question?
